Vertical Habitat Use by Japanese Jack Mackerel Trachurus japonicus Inferred From a Biologging Study in Tokyo Bay

open access: yesFisheries Oceanography, Volume 35, Issue 4, Page 518-531, July 2026.
ABSTRACT The movement ecology of Trachurus japonicus in the adult stage remains poorly understood because observing their underwater behavior over long periods is challenging. This study aimed to examine vertical habitat use by T. japonicus using electronic tags. Ninety fish were tagged and released in November 2022 in Tokyo Bay, Japan.

Individual specialization and temporal changes in Antarctic fur seal trophic ecology from a multi‐tracer approach

open access: yesEcosphere, Volume 17, Issue 6, June 2026.
Abstract Substantial individual variation in diet and foraging strategies can exist within populations. These differences can enhance individual foraging efficiency, reduce intraspecific competition, and provide fitness advantages that increase the resilience of a population.
